From mboxrd@z Thu Jan 1 00:00:00 1970 From: Ville =?iso-8859-1?Q?Syrj=E4l=E4?= Subject: Re: [PATCH 11/12] drm/i915/skl: Remove WaSetDisablePixMaskCammingAndRhwoInCommonSliceChicken Date: Fri, 25 Sep 2015 21:43:44 +0300 Message-ID: <20150925184344.GK26517@intel.com> References: <1443188026-1222-1-git-send-email-arun.siluvery@linux.intel.com> <1443188026-1222-12-git-send-email-arun.siluvery@linux.intel.com> <20150925183413.GJ26517@intel.com> Mime-Version: 1.0 Content-Type: text/plain; charset="utf-8" Content-Transfer-Encoding: base64 Return-path: Received: from mga01.intel.com (mga01.intel.com [192.55.52.88]) by gabe.freedesktop.org (Postfix) with ESMTP id 636E66E521 for ; Fri, 25 Sep 2015 11:43:48 -0700 (PDT) Content-Disposition: inline In-Reply-To: <20150925183413.GJ26517@intel.com> List-Unsubscribe: , List-Archive: List-Post: List-Help: List-Subscribe: , Errors-To: intel-gfx-bounces@lists.freedesktop.org Sender: "Intel-gfx" To: Arun Siluvery Cc: intel-gfx@lists.freedesktop.org, Mika Kuoppala List-Id: intel-gfx@lists.freedesktop.org T24gRnJpLCBTZXAgMjUsIDIwMTUgYXQgMDk6MzQ6MTNQTSArMDMwMCwgVmlsbGUgU3lyasOkbMOk IHdyb3RlOgo+IE9uIEZyaSwgU2VwIDI1LCAyMDE1IGF0IDAyOjMzOjQ1UE0gKzAxMDAsIEFydW4g U2lsdXZlcnkgd3JvdGU6Cj4gPiBEcm9wcGluZyBpdCBhcyBpdCBpcyBmb3IgcHJlLXByb2R1Y3Rp b24gc3RlcHBpbmcuCj4gPiAKPiA+IFNpZ25lZC1vZmYtYnk6IEFydW4gU2lsdXZlcnkgPGFydW4u c2lsdXZlcnlAbGludXguaW50ZWwuY29tPgo+ID4gLS0tCj4gPiAgZHJpdmVycy9ncHUvZHJtL2k5 MTUvaW50ZWxfbHJjLmMgICAgICAgIHwgIDUgKystLS0KPiA+ICBkcml2ZXJzL2dwdS9kcm0vaTkx NS9pbnRlbF9yaW5nYnVmZmVyLmMgfCAyMyArKysrKysrKysrKy0tLS0tLS0tLS0tLQo+ID4gIDIg ZmlsZXMgY2hhbmdlZCwgMTMgaW5zZXJ0aW9ucygrKSwgMTUgZGVsZXRpb25zKC0pCj4gPiAKPiA+ IGRpZmYgLS1naXQgYS9kcml2ZXJzL2dwdS9kcm0vaTkxNS9pbnRlbF9scmMuYyBiL2RyaXZlcnMv Z3B1L2RybS9pOTE1L2ludGVsX2xyYy5jCj4gPiBpbmRleCAyNTYxNjdiLi5lM2JhZmZkIDEwMDY0 NAo+ID4gLS0tIGEvZHJpdmVycy9ncHUvZHJtL2k5MTUvaW50ZWxfbHJjLmMKPiA+ICsrKyBiL2Ry aXZlcnMvZ3B1L2RybS9pOTE1L2ludGVsX2xyYy5jCj4gPiBAQCAtMTM1Miw5ICsxMzUyLDggQEAg c3RhdGljIGludCBnZW45X2luaXRfcGVyY3R4X2JiKHN0cnVjdCBpbnRlbF9lbmdpbmVfY3MgKnJp bmcsCj4gPiAgCXN0cnVjdCBkcm1fZGV2aWNlICpkZXYgPSByaW5nLT5kZXY7Cj4gPiAgCXVpbnQz Ml90IGluZGV4ID0gd2FfY3R4X3N0YXJ0KHdhX2N0eCwgKm9mZnNldCwgQ0FDSEVMSU5FX0RXT1JE Uyk7Cj4gPiAgCj4gPiAtCS8qIFdhU2V0RGlzYWJsZVBpeE1hc2tDYW1taW5nQW5kUmh3b0luQ29t bW9uU2xpY2VDaGlja2VuOnNrbCxieHQgKi8KPiA+IC0JaWYgKChJU19TS1lMQUtFKGRldikgJiYg KElOVEVMX1JFVklEKGRldikgPD0gU0tMX1JFVklEX0IwKSkgfHwKPiA+IC0JICAgIChJU19CUk9Y VE9OKGRldikgJiYgKElOVEVMX1JFVklEKGRldikgPT0gQlhUX1JFVklEX0EwKSkpIHsKPiA+ICsJ LyogV2FTZXREaXNhYmxlUGl4TWFza0NhbW1pbmdBbmRSaHdvSW5Db21tb25TbGljZUNoaWNrZW46 Ynh0ICovCj4gPiArCWlmIChJU19CUk9YVE9OKGRldikgJiYgKElOVEVMX1JFVklEKGRldikgPT0g QlhUX1JFVklEX0EwKSkgewo+ID4gIAkJd2FfY3R4X2VtaXQoYmF0Y2gsIGluZGV4LCBNSV9MT0FE X1JFR0lTVEVSX0lNTSgxKSk7Cj4gPiAgCQl3YV9jdHhfZW1pdChiYXRjaCwgaW5kZXgsIEdFTjlf U0xJQ0VfQ09NTU9OX0VDT19DSElDS0VOMCk7Cj4gPiAgCQl3YV9jdHhfZW1pdChiYXRjaCwgaW5k ZXgsCj4gCj4gTG9va3MgbGlrZSB3ZSBoYXZlIHNvbWUgZHVwbGljYXRlZCBkZWZpbmVzIGFuZCB3 aGF0bm90LiBTZWUKPiBXYURpc2FibGVNYXNrQmFzZWRDYW1taW5nSW5SQ0M6c2tsLGJ4dCBpbiBn ZW45X2luaXRfd29ya2Fyb3VuZHMoKS4KPiBNYXliZSB5b3UgY2FuIGZpZ3VyZSBvdXQgd2h5IHdl IGhhdmUgdGhlIHNhbWUgc3R1ZmYgaW4gdHdvIHBsYWNlcz8KCk9oIGFuZCB0aGVyZSdzIGFsc28g CldhRGlzYWJsZVBpeGVsTWFza0Jhc2VkQ2FtbWluZ0luUmNwYmUKd2hpY2ggd2Ugc2VlbSB0byBi ZSBtaXNzaW5nLi4uCgo+IAo+ID4gZGlmZiAtLWdpdCBhL2RyaXZlcnMvZ3B1L2RybS9pOTE1L2lu dGVsX3JpbmdidWZmZXIuYyBiL2RyaXZlcnMvZ3B1L2RybS9pOTE1L2ludGVsX3JpbmdidWZmZXIu Ywo+ID4gaW5kZXggOTYzYjNjYS4uZDVmZGJjOCAxMDA2NDQKPiA+IC0tLSBhL2RyaXZlcnMvZ3B1 L2RybS9pOTE1L2ludGVsX3JpbmdidWZmZXIuYwo+ID4gKysrIGIvZHJpdmVycy9ncHUvZHJtL2k5 MTUvaW50ZWxfcmluZ2J1ZmZlci5jCj4gPiBAQCAtOTMxLDE4ICs5MzEsNiBAQCBzdGF0aWMgaW50 IGdlbjlfaW5pdF93b3JrYXJvdW5kcyhzdHJ1Y3QgaW50ZWxfZW5naW5lX2NzICpyaW5nKQo+ID4g IAkJCQkgIEdFTjlfREdfTUlSUk9SX0ZJWF9FTkFCTEUpOwo+ID4gIAl9Cj4gPiAgCj4gPiAtCWlm ICgoSVNfU0tZTEFLRShkZXYpICYmIElOVEVMX1JFVklEKGRldikgPD0gU0tMX1JFVklEX0IwKSB8 fAo+ID4gLQkgICAgKElTX0JST1hUT04oZGV2KSAmJiBJTlRFTF9SRVZJRChkZXYpIDwgQlhUX1JF VklEX0IwKSkgewo+ID4gLQkJLyogV2FTZXREaXNhYmxlUGl4TWFza0NhbW1pbmdBbmRSaHdvSW5D b21tb25TbGljZUNoaWNrZW46c2tsLGJ4dCAqLwo+ID4gLQkJV0FfU0VUX0JJVF9NQVNLRUQoR0VO N19DT01NT05fU0xJQ0VfQ0hJQ0tFTjEsCj4gPiAtCQkJCSAgR0VOOV9SSFdPX09QVElNSVpBVElP Tl9ESVNBQkxFKTsKPiA+IC0JCS8qCj4gPiAtCQkgKiBXQSBhbHNvIHJlcXVpcmVzIEdFTjlfU0xJ Q0VfQ09NTU9OX0VDT19DSElDS0VOMFsxNDoxNF0gdG8gYmUgc2V0Cj4gPiAtCQkgKiBidXQgd2Ug ZG8gdGhhdCBpbiBwZXIgY3R4IGJhdGNoYnVmZmVyIGFzIHRoZXJlIGlzIGFuIGlzc3VlCj4gPiAt CQkgKiB3aXRoIHRoaXMgcmVnaXN0ZXIgbm90IGdldHRpbmcgcmVzdG9yZWQgb24gY3R4IHJlc3Rv cmUKPiA+IC0JCSAqLwo+ID4gLQl9Cj4gPiAtCj4gPiAgCWlmICgoSVNfU0tZTEFLRShkZXYpICYm IElOVEVMX1JFVklEKGRldikgPj0gU0tMX1JFVklEX0MwKSB8fAo+ID4gIAkgICAgSVNfQlJPWFRP TihkZXYpKSB7Cj4gPiAgCQkvKiBXYUVuYWJsZVlWMTJCdWdGaXhJbkhhbGZTbGljZUNoaWNrZW43 OnNrbCxieHQgKi8KPiA+IEBAIC0xMDg1LDYgKzEwNzMsMTcgQEAgc3RhdGljIGludCBieHRfaW5p dF93b3JrYXJvdW5kcyhzdHJ1Y3QgaW50ZWxfZW5naW5lX2NzICpyaW5nKQo+ID4gIAkJCUdFTjdf U0JFX1NTX0NBQ0hFX0RJU1BBVENIX1BPUlRfU0hBUklOR19ESVNBQkxFKTsKPiA+ICAJfQo+ID4g IAo+ID4gKwkvKiBXYVNldERpc2FibGVQaXhNYXNrQ2FtbWluZ0FuZFJod29JbkNvbW1vblNsaWNl Q2hpY2tlbjpieHQgKi8KPiA+ICsJaWYgKElOVEVMX1JFVklEKGRldikgPCBCWFRfUkVWSURfQjAp IHsKPiA+ICsJCVdBX1NFVF9CSVRfTUFTS0VEKEdFTjdfQ09NTU9OX1NMSUNFX0NISUNLRU4xLAo+ ID4gKwkJCQkgIEdFTjlfUkhXT19PUFRJTUlaQVRJT05fRElTQUJMRSk7Cj4gPiArCQkvKgo+ID4g KwkJICogV0EgYWxzbyByZXF1aXJlcyBHRU45X1NMSUNFX0NPTU1PTl9FQ09fQ0hJQ0tFTjBbMTQ6 MTRdIHRvIGJlIHNldAo+ID4gKwkJICogYnV0IHdlIGRvIHRoYXQgaW4gcGVyIGN0eCBiYXRjaGJ1 ZmZlciBhcyB0aGVyZSBpcyBhbiBpc3N1ZQo+ID4gKwkJICogd2l0aCB0aGlzIHJlZ2lzdGVyIG5v dCBnZXR0aW5nIHJlc3RvcmVkIG9uIGN0eCByZXN0b3JlCj4gPiArCQkgKi8KPiA+ICsJfQo+ID4g Kwo+IAo+IAo+ID4gIAlyZXR1cm4gMDsKPiA+ICB9Cj4gPiAgCj4gPiAtLSAKPiA+IDEuOS4xCj4g PiAKPiA+IF9fX19fX19fX19fX19fX19fX19fX19fX19fX19fX19fX19fX19fX19fX19fX19fCj4g PiBJbnRlbC1nZnggbWFpbGluZyBsaXN0Cj4gPiBJbnRlbC1nZnhAbGlzdHMuZnJlZWRlc2t0b3Au b3JnCj4gPiBodHRwOi8vbGlzdHMuZnJlZWRlc2t0b3Aub3JnL21haWxtYW4vbGlzdGluZm8vaW50 ZWwtZ2Z4Cj4gCj4gLS0gCj4gVmlsbGUgU3lyasOkbMOkCj4gSW50ZWwgT1RDCj4gX19fX19fX19f X19fX19fX19fX19fX19fX19fX19fX19fX19fX19fX19fX19fX18KPiBJbnRlbC1nZnggbWFpbGlu ZyBsaXN0Cj4gSW50ZWwtZ2Z4QGxpc3RzLmZyZWVkZXNrdG9wLm9yZwo+IGh0dHA6Ly9saXN0cy5m cmVlZGVza3RvcC5vcmcvbWFpbG1hbi9saXN0aW5mby9pbnRlbC1nZngKCi0tIApWaWxsZSBTeXJq w6Rsw6QKSW50ZWwgT1RDCl9fX19fX19fX19fX19fX19fX19fX19fX19fX19fX19fX19fX19fX19f X19fX19fCkludGVsLWdmeCBtYWlsaW5nIGxpc3QKSW50ZWwtZ2Z4QGxpc3RzLmZyZWVkZXNrdG9w Lm9yZwpodHRwOi8vbGlzdHMuZnJlZWRlc2t0b3Aub3JnL21haWxtYW4vbGlzdGluZm8vaW50ZWwt Z2Z4Cg==